The Certified Specialist Programme in Cardiac Anatomy provides in-depth knowledge of the heart's intricate structure and function. Participants will develop a comprehensive understanding of the cardiovascular system, essential for professionals in related fields.
Learning outcomes include mastering complex anatomical terminology, identifying key structures through various imaging modalities (including echocardiography and CT scans), and applying anatomical knowledge to clinical scenarios. Successful completion leads to a globally recognized certification, enhancing career prospects.
The programme's duration typically spans several months, delivered through a blended learning approach combining online modules, practical workshops, and potentially case studies. The specific timeframe may vary depending on the provider.
